The sparky marigold displays fiery colors in bunching 2 in. blooms, making it an excellent choice for container gardening. From our farms to your garden, grow confidently knowing all our seeds are 100% Organic and Non-GMO. Ready, set, grow.

Hi BillS! Lemon Queen sunflowers are best planted in Delaware between Mid-April and late May, once the danger of the last spring frost as passed and the soil warms to at least 55° to 60° Fahrenheit. For succession planting or staggered blooms that last from mid-summer through autumn, you can continue sowing seeds every two to three weeks until early July. Hi Mike! Our Organic Wildflower Mix - 'Rainbow Blooms' 250mg seed packet typically covers approximately 20 to 25 square feet (roughly a 5' x5' area). This small amount is usually intended for detailed, small-scale planting, such as filling in small gaps, border gardening, or container, rather than large-scale meadow seeding.
